J. D. Eshelby is a scholar working on Mechanics of Materials, Materials Chemistry and Mechanical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, J. D. Eshelby has authored 46 papers receiving a total of 18.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Mechanics of Materials, 19 papers in Materials Chemistry and 14 papers in Mechanical Engineering. Recurrent topics in J. D. Eshelby's work include Microstructure and mechanical properties (9 papers), Composite Material Mechanics (8 papers) and Material Properties and Failure Mechanisms (7 papers). J. D. Eshelby is often cited by papers focused on Microstructure and mechanical properties (9 papers), Composite Material Mechanics (8 papers) and Material Properties and Failure Mechanisms (7 papers). J. D. Eshelby coll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Russia. J. D. Eshelby's co-authors include F. C. Frank, F. R. N. Nabarro, W. T. Read, W. Shockley, P. L. Pratt, C. Atkinson, A. N. Stroh, A. B. Lidiard, C. W. A. Newey and B. A. Bilby and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Applied Physics, Journal of Applied Mechanics and Tectonophysics.
